#65eea5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65eea5 is composed of 39.6% red, 93.3%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.7%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 148 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 66.5%. #65eea5 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#00dd4b.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#65eea5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#65eea5 has RGB values of R:101, G:238,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6680229.

Shades and Tints of #65eea5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f2f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#65eea5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7aca9 is the less saturated color, while #58fba4 is the most saturated one.
